From 6239edadfa526987f42a54803c97b904df6e395a Mon Sep 17 00:00:00 2001 From: cwchen <1048842385@qq.com> Date: Mon, 17 Jun 2024 11:00:28 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BA=BA=E5=91=98=E5=87=BA=E5=85=A5=E7=AE=A1?= =?UTF-8?q?=E7=90=86?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../screen/service/impl/AccessMgeServiceImpl.java | 9 +++++---- .../src/main/resources/mapper/AccessMgeMapper.xml | 10 ++++++++-- 2 files changed, 13 insertions(+), 6 deletions(-) diff --git a/securitycontrol-model/securitycontrol-screen/src/main/java/com/securitycontrol/screen/service/impl/AccessMgeServiceImpl.java b/securitycontrol-model/securitycontrol-screen/src/main/java/com/securitycontrol/screen/service/impl/AccessMgeServiceImpl.java index 84376bf..56574c0 100644 --- a/securitycontrol-model/securitycontrol-screen/src/main/java/com/securitycontrol/screen/service/impl/AccessMgeServiceImpl.java +++ b/securitycontrol-model/securitycontrol-screen/src/main/java/com/securitycontrol/screen/service/impl/AccessMgeServiceImpl.java @@ -100,7 +100,8 @@ public class AccessMgeServiceImpl implements AccessMgeService { String base64 = item.getString("url"); vo.setBase64(base64); } - vo.setPersonName(handleData(vo.getSourceData())); + vo.setPersonName(handleData(vo.getSourceData(),"personName")); + vo.setAccesssTime(handleData(vo.getSourceData(),"dataTime")); } if(i == 0 || i == 1){ noWarnList.add(vo); @@ -116,14 +117,14 @@ public class AccessMgeServiceImpl implements AccessMgeService { return AjaxResult.success(map); } - public static String handleData(String jsonStr){ + public static String handleData(String jsonStr,String fieldName){ try { if(StringUtils.isEmpty(jsonStr)){ return null; }else{ JSONObject jsonObject = JSONObject.parseObject(jsonStr); - String personName = jsonObject.getString("personName"); - return personName; + String value = jsonObject.getString(fieldName); + return value; } } catch (Exception e) { log.error("人员出入数据解析异常",e); diff --git a/securitycontrol-model/securitycontrol-screen/src/main/resources/mapper/AccessMgeMapper.xml b/securitycontrol-model/securitycontrol-screen/src/main/resources/mapper/AccessMgeMapper.xml index d55eb2f..a13fb53 100644 --- a/securitycontrol-model/securitycontrol-screen/src/main/resources/mapper/AccessMgeMapper.xml +++ b/securitycontrol-model/securitycontrol-screen/src/main/resources/mapper/AccessMgeMapper.xml @@ -67,13 +67,19 @@